A plane polarized light is incident on a polariser with its pass axis making angle ? with x-axis, as shown in the figure. At four different values of θ,θ=8∘,38∘,188∘ and 218∘, the observed intensities are same. What is the angle between the direction of polarization and x-axis ?
A
98∘
B
128∘
C
203∘
D
45∘
Answer
203∘
Explanation
Solution
According to Malus law, we have
I=I0cos2θ⇒I0I=cos2θ
Since the observed intensities are same for all values of θ,
therefore, for the angles given in options, the observed intensity
should be same as well for all θ,θ=8∘,38∘,188∘ and 218∘,I0I∼0.9
and for θ=203∘,II∼0.9.
Therefore, angle between direction of polarisation and x axis is 203∘.
